Healing happens in relationship and I create a heart-centered space for our work together. I have many years of experience working with clients on issues ranging from anxiety to relationship difficulties and life transitions. I use a therapy model called Internal Family Systems (IFS), which helps you understand the different parts of you that are experiencing challenges. For instance, there may be a part of you who is a perfectionist, or a part that may feel overwhelming anxiety. We get to know these parts of you in a compassionate and curious way, which helps you to get to the root cause. Through this clarity, a spaciousness opens up in your psyche and body, which can often lead to profound healing. I teach clients how to engage their mind, body, and spirit in the healing process.

You understand your childhood. You can name the patterns, trace the dynamics, explain exactly how it shaped you. But understanding hasn't changed how your body responds. You still brace when someone raises their voice. You still go quiet when you need something. You still feel that familiar flatness where emotion should be. Maybe you've done therapy before and it helped you see things more clearly. But the felt experience of being different hasn't caught up. That gap between knowing and feeling is real, and it isn't a failure of effort. It's where body-centered work begins. I offer a free 20-minute consultation.
